Use a clear 6-16mm hose cut long enough to go from bottom of fryer over the edge and down to the floor.
stand upright and suck on hose watching it fill towards your mouth,within a inch or two of mouth rempve from mouth and block with thumb, lower thumb and hose to recepicle that is lower that the bottom of fryer and release thumb.
Shit the bed you just drained the fryer!.
You don't need to suck it. Just lower into the fryer (cold of course) until the end is an inch or so from the surface. Block with your thumb and lift out and over the side to the bucket where it's to be drained. Release thumb.
